Part Datasheet Review: 10163479-14340T1LF
Date: 2026-07-13
Source Checked
  • Flux project/part: 10163479-14340T1LF
  • Official datasheet/drawing already present in the part property: https://cdn.amphenol-cs.com/media/wysiwyg/files/drawing/10163479.pdf
  • Datasheet source: Amphenol Communications Solutions / Amphenol FCI drawing 10163479, Rev. C, released.
No Datasheet URL update was required because the official Amphenol URL was already set.
Available Part Information in Flux

Table


FieldFlux valueDatasheet check
Manufacturer Part Number10163479-14340T1LFMatches ordering code/family.
Manufacturer NameAmphenol Communications SolutionsMatches Amphenol FCI / Amphenol ICC source.
Description400 Position Connector Plug, Outer Shroud Contacts Surface Mount GoldConsistent with COM-HPC plug assembly, 400-position board-to-board connector.
Part TypeConnectorsFunctionally correct; canonical singular Connector would be cleaner if normalized later.
MountSurface MountConsistent with connector contact style / SMT mount representation.
Designator PrefixJAppropriate for connector.
Pin count / positions400 schematic terminalsMatches datasheet 400 positions.
Datasheet URLAmphenol PDF URLOfficial URL already present.
Key Datasheet Specs

Table


SpecValue
Product familyCOM-HPC plug assembly, board-to-board
Positions400
RowsA, B, C, D; 100 positions per row
Pitch0.635 mm typical
Contact span62.865 mm over 99 intervals per row
Row geometryOuter row span 6.80 mm ref; adjacent rows 2.20 mm typ with 2.40 mm between inner rows
Contact pad/hole diameterØ0.356 ±0.050 mm typical
Mounting/locating holesØ0.975 ±0.050 mm NPTH, 2 places
Overall outline68.62 mm length ref; 8.75 mm width ref
Height option3.40 mm (340 code)
Plating1 code = 10 µin Au over 50 µin min Ni
MaterialHigh-performance thermoplastic housing; copper alloy contacts
Current rating0.3 A all contacts powered, or 1.2 A one contact per row, 30 °C max temperature rise condition
Voltage rating150 VAC
Operating temperature-55 °C to +125 °C
Packaging / pickupTape & reel; Mylar tape pickup option
Schematic Symbol Cross-Check
Matches
  • The schematic contains 400 terminal components.
  • Terminal naming covers A1-A100, B1-B100, C1-C100, and D1-D100, matching the four-row 400-position datasheet scheme.
  • Pin Number properties match the terminal designators.
  • No schematic nets are present, which is normal for a connector part project.
Mismatches / Quality Issues
  • Datasheet labels show examples as A01, A100, D01, D100. Flux uses A1/D1 without leading zero. This is not electrically wrong, but exact datasheet label formatting is not preserved for 1-9.
  • Pin Description is absent on the terminals. For connector usability, each terminal should ideally have a description equal to the positional name, e.g. A1 or A01.
  • Pin Type is Unspecified on inspected terminals. Connector contacts should ideally use a connector-appropriate passive/bidirectional type for clearer ERC behavior.
Footprint Cross-Check
Contact Pad Array
The 400 contact pads appear consistent with the datasheet when interpreting the layout tool's small numeric values as internal meter-style values equivalent to physical millimeters:

Table


FeatureFlux footprintDatasheetVerdict
Contact pads400400Match
Contact pitch0.635 mm inferred0.635 mm typMatch
Contact span~62.864-62.865 mm62.865 mmMatch
Row Y positions+3.4, +1.2, -1.2, -3.4 mm6.80 mm span; 2.20/2.40/2.20 spacingMatch
Contact pad diameter0.356 mm circularØ0.356 ±0.050 mmMatch
Mounting / NPTH Pads
The footprint has two additional circular pads, matching the expected count for two mounting/locating holes, and the diameter matches Ø0.975 mm. Positioning is not fully aligned with the datasheet extraction:

Table


FeatureFlux footprintDatasheet extractionVerdict
Mount hole count22Match
Mount hole diameter0.975 mmØ0.975 ±0.050 mmMatch
Mount hole X spacingAppears ±33.56 mm, total 67.12 mmExtraction indicates 68.62 mm reference / possible center spacingNeeds visual confirmation; likely mismatch if 68.62 mm is hole center spacing
Mount hole YOne at -1.30 mm, one at 0.00 mmExtraction indicates 1.30 mm vertical coordinate from centerlineLikely mismatch; Y=0 hole is suspicious
The strongest flagged issue is the mounting/NPTH placement, especially one mounting hole at Y=0.00 mm. Because the drawing OCR is ambiguous about whether 68.62 mm is outline length or mount-hole center spacing, the X-coordinate should be visually confirmed from the PDF before correction.
Overall Verdict
  • Identity, datasheet URL, 400-position schematic count, and contact pad field geometry are consistent with the official Amphenol drawing.
  • The part should not be considered fully verified until the two mounting/NPTH hole coordinates are visually confirmed and corrected if needed.
  • Schematic terminal descriptions and pin types should be improved for usability, though they do not invalidate the contact geometry.
  1. Visually verify the two mounting/NPTH center coordinates from the Amphenol PDF drawing.
  2. Correct the mounting/NPTH pad Y coordinate if the second hole should also be offset by 1.30 mm from the centerline.
  3. Confirm whether mount-hole X centers should be ±34.31 mm or ±33.56 mm.
  4. Add terminal pin descriptions matching positional names.
  5. Change terminal Pin Type from Unspecified to a connector-appropriate passive/bidirectional type if supported by the library workflow.
